HAVING suffered two consecutive Essex Senior League defeats, Great Wakering Rovers will be aiming to bounce back to winning ways in the FA Vase.

Iain O’Connell’s side make the trip to Holland FC for their first round tie tonight, and moving a step closer to Wembley will be at the forefront of their minds.

An away defeat to Clapton last weekend resulted in Wakering losing their grip on top spot.

And the chances of an instant return to the Isthmian North, following their relegation last term, was furthered hampered by a 1-0 defeat at home to Sawbridgeworth Town in midweek.

But the Eastern Counties League Division One side will be looking to compound Wakering’s misery and condemn O’Connell’s charges to three losses on the spin this evening.

Meanwhile, Basildon United will also be in FA Vase action as they welcome Biggleswade to the Stuart Bingham Stadium tomorrow.

The 3-1 win over Barkingside last time out, which came after a 3-2 reverse at Woodford Town, saw Marc Harrison’s men climb back up to second in the Essex Senior League standings.

And, having made an impressive start to the season following Harrison’s appointment as Aaron Bloxham’s successor in the summer, the Bees will be confident of seeing off the Spartan South Midlands Premier Division visitors and book their place in the next round of the competition.

Hullbridge Sports will take on Colney Heath, with the side looking to build confidence and put together an unbeaten streak.

Sports have only mustered three Essex Senior League victories so far this campaign.

And a win over the SSMFL Premier Division side would allow Sports to progress to the second round of the competition.

Meanwhile, Southend Manor will be in Essex Senior League action.

And with a host of divisional rivals in cup action, Stuart Marshall’s side will be eager to climb the standings.

Bottom of the table Wadham Lodge are tomorrow’s visitors.

A surprise Essex Senior Cup win over National League South frontrunners Braintree Town has resulted in an upturn in form, which Manor will be looking to continue.
